>>108643161
it all comes down to:
>do you prefer all your packages to be newer?
if yeah, Fedora. i've used both and they are reliable and great for a daily drive. for me, what sells on debian is the lts, huge amount of packages, community run, compatibility and how tight it all feels: got a nice minimal installer, the possibility to go testing if i want and the peace of mind i get under a stable/slower base, allowing me to do my thing at my own pace.
